O exemplo deste artigo informa o método de interface Java, polimorfismo, herança e triângulo de computação de classe e comprimento e área retangular. Compartilhe para todos para sua referência. Os detalhes são os seguintes:
Defina as especificações da interface:
/ ** * @Author VVV * @Date 2013-8-10 AM 08:56:48 */ pacote com.duotai;/ ** ** * * * * */ forma de interface pública {public duplo área (); (); ; .s2 = s2; Os três re -entradas do comprimento da borda! (S1 + s3 <s2) {return false;} if (s2 + s3 <s1) {return false;} retorna true;} / * * (não javadoc) * * @see com.duotai.shape#área () * / @Override C Double Area () {Double P = (S1 + S2 + S3) / 2; / * * (não -javadoc) * * @see com.duotai.shape#mais () * / @Override public Doubro mais () {return s1 + s2 + s3;} / ** * @authouse vvv * @date 2013 -8-10 Am 09: 12:06 */ pacote com.duotai;/ ** * * */ Diretor de classe pública implementa a forma {Double S1; S2) {this.s1 = s1; Método gerado automaticamente stub retorno s1 * s2;} / * * (não javadoc) * * @see com.duotai.shape#mais () * / @Override public Double mais () {// TODO Método Enerado Auto-Ga Retorno de Stub 2 * (S1 + S2);}} /** * @Author VVV * @Date 2013-8-10 Am 09:13:30 * /package com.duotai; teste { / * * @param args * / public static void main (string [] args) {Shape Triangle = novo triângulo (3, 4, 8); 5); Triângulo Triângulo é: " + Triângulo.area ()); System.out.println (" A circunferência do tri -triangular é: + Tri.longer ()); é: " + tri.area ()); system.out.println (" O perímetro do retângulo é: + diretor.longer ()); ());}}Espera -se que este artigo seja útil para o design do programa Java de todos.